Resonance: Definition, Types, Frequency Examples However, more specifically, the definition of resonance in physics is when the frequency of an external oscillation or vibration matches an object (or cavity's) natural frequency, and as a result either causes it to vibrate or increases its amplitude of oscillation
Resonance - Physics Book Resonance is the physical phenomenon in which a system vibrates in response to an applied frequency, but the external force of this frequency interacts with the object in such a way that it causes the system to oscillate with a maximum amplitude due to the specific frequency induced
